To rename the fraction \( \frac{2}{3} \) as a whole number times a unit fraction, we first express \( \frac{2}{3} \) in a suitable form.

A unit fraction is a fraction where the numerator is 1. We can express \( \frac{2}{3} \) as:

\[
\frac{2}{3} = 2 \times \frac{1}{3}
\]

Now substituting this into the original expression gives:

\[
54 \times \frac{2}{3} = 54 \times \left( 2 \times \frac{1}{3} \right)
\]

This can be simplified by rearranging the terms:

\[
54 \times \frac{2}{3} = (54 \times 2) \times \frac{1}{3} = 108 \times \frac{1}{3}
\]

So, the expression \( 54 \times \frac{2}{3} \) can be written as:

\[
108 \times \frac{1}{3}
\]

Thus, the answer is:

\[
=
108 \times \frac{1}{3}
\]
